Iron Chef
Entertainment
25 x 60'

The ultimate Japanese cooking sensation reformatted for access prime time.

Teams of eager culinary challengers compete with four resident Iron Chefs in a high-energy cook-off. In each programme, the Iron Chefs take on their challengers in a timed battle and must prepare superlative dishes based on each day's special ingredient, anything from aubergine to octopus. The dishes are then judged by expert food critics, with the winner declared at the end of the show.

In the stripped version, a week of programmes culminates in a grand ‘Friday Final’ where the best contender of the week goes head-to-head with the week’s strongest Iron Chef. And if the challenger wins this final cook-off, they win a cash prize. The competition takes place in an amazing pressure cooker of an arena called ‘Kitchen Stadium’, and the battle presided over by ‘The Chairman’, an enigmatic Japanese ring master who embodies the ancient heritage of the competition. Allez cuisine!

Based on “Iron Chef”: an original programme by Fuji Television Network, Inc

New Channel 4 cookery series Iron Chef UK served up more than million viewers on its debut. Based on a Japanese gladiatorial ‘cook-off ’ format, which has also proved a hit in the US, the British version cooked up an average audience of 920,000 (7.9%) across the 5pm hour. It picked up an additional 108,000 (0.6%) an hour later on C4+1, taking the total audience to 1.03m.
